Dogs are barking

Feet hurt. This is an old expression, typically associated with the South and especially concentrated around the Appalachian Mountain chain. Older usage didn't connote smelly or dirty feet, just sore feet.

There is a brand of shoe called "Hush Puppy" and it's is named that as a reference to the expression, "My dogs are barking." In the case of the shoe, Hush Puppies are supposedly so comfortable they can quiet your puppies - that is, stop your feet from hurting.

beaking off

(Canadian usage)

1)To be verbally insolent, belligerent or insubordinate;

2)To be mouthy to or backtalk someone;

3)To complain profusely about something.
"I'd love to dig a new trench, Sergeant. And if I thought you knew what you were talking about, I might do it."
"Are you beaking off, Corporal?"

"He's still beaking off about losing the election, and that was six months ago!"
